Įsivaizduokite, kad paleidžiate „Windows 11“ kompiuterį virtualiai mašinai, bet susiduriate su baisia „Hyper-V Virtual Switch“ klaida. 😩 Tai erzina, tiesa? Ši dažna problema gali sutrikdyti jūsų darbo eigą, nesvarbu, ar esate kūrėjas, testuojantis programas, ar tiesiog eksperimentuojantis su virtualiomis mašinomis. Tačiau nesijaudinkite – jūs ne vienas, ir tai ištaisoma!
Šiame paprastame vadove panagrinėsime „Windows 11 Hyper-V Virtual Switch“ klaidos esmę , paaiškinsime, kas tai yra, kodėl ji atsiranda ir, svarbiausia, kaip greitai ištaisyti „Hyper-V Virtual Switch“ klaidą . Galiausiai jūsų virtualus tinklas vėl veiks sklandžiai. Pradėkime! 🌟
Kas yra „Hyper-V Virtual Switch“ klaida sistemoje „Windows 11“?
„ Hyper -V“ virtualusis jungiklis yra pagrindinis „Microsoft Hyper-V“ virtualizacijos platformos komponentas sistemoje „Windows 11“. Jis veikia kaip virtualus tinklo tiltas, jungiantis jūsų pagrindinį kompiuterį su virtualiomis mašinomis (VM), kad būtų užtikrintas sklandus tinklo veikimas. Kai kas nors nepavyksta, galite matyti tokias klaidas kaip „Virtualus jungiklis nerastas“, „Tinklo adapterio problemos“ arba „Hyper-V negali sukurti virtualaus jungiklio“.
Ši klaida dažnai pasirodo kuriant VM arba konfigūruojant tinklo nustatymus „Hyper-V Manager“. Ji dažniau pasitaiko sistemoje „Windows 11“ dėl griežtesnių saugos funkcijų ir atnaujinimų, kurie kartais nesuderinami su virtualizacijos tvarkyklėmis. Geros naujienos? Daugelį priežasčių lengva išspręsti, todėl sutaupoma daug laiko.
Dažniausios „Hyper-V“ virtualiojo jungiklio klaidos priežastys
Suprasdami problemos šaknį, galėsite ją greičiau išspręsti. Čia pateikiamos pagrindinės „Hyper-V Virtual Switch“ klaidos „Windows 11“ sistemoje priežastys :
- 1️⃣ Nesuderinamos arba pasenusios tvarkyklės: Neatnaujintos tinklo adapterio tvarkyklės gali konfliktuoti su „Hyper-V“.
- 2️⃣ BIOS / UEFI virtualizacijos nustatymai: jei VT-x (Intel) arba AMD-V neįgalintas, „Hyper-V“ sunkiai kuria jungiklius.
- 3️⃣ Konfliktuojanti programinė įranga: VPN klientai, trečiųjų šalių užkardos arba antivirusinės programos gali blokuoti virtualų tinklą.
- 4️⃣ Sugadinti „Hyper-V“ komponentai: „Windows“ naujinimai kartais gali palikti „Hyper-V“ trikdžiančią būseną.
- 5️⃣ Išteklių apribojimai: Nepakankamas RAM arba procesoriaus paskirstymas „Hyper-V“ gali sukelti komutatoriaus kūrimo triktis.
Pastebėjote kurį nors iš šių dalykų savo sistemoje? Skaitykite toliau ir sužinokite, kaip juos išspręsti. Kai viskas bus sutvarkyta, pajusite palengvėjimo bangą! 👏
Žingsnis po žingsnio ištaisymai, kaip pašalinti „Hyper-V“ virtualiojo jungiklio klaidą
Pasiraitojame rankoves ir imkimės šios problemos. Pradėsime nuo paprasčiausių sprendimų ir, jei reikia, pereisime prie tolesnių veiksmų. Atlikite šiuos veiksmus iš eilės – dauguma vartotojų problemą išsprendžia atlikdami 3 veiksmą. Nepamirškite po kiekvieno svarbaus pakeitimo paleisti kompiuterio iš naujo, kad pataisymai įsigaliotų.
1 veiksmas: įjunkite virtualizaciją BIOS / UEFI
Pirmiausia: įsitikinkite, kad jūsų aparatinė įranga palaiko „Hyper-V“. Paleiskite kompiuterį iš naujo ir įeikite į BIOS (paprastai paspaudus Del, F2 arba F10 paleidimo metu – žr. pagrindinės plokštės vadovą).
- Eikite į skirtuką „Išplėstinė“ arba „CPU konfigūracija“ .
- Įjunkite „Intel VT-x“ (arba „AMD-V/SVM“ , jei naudojate AMD procesorius) ir „VT-d“ (IOMMU palaikymui).
- Išsaugoti ir išeiti (F10 + Enter).
Grįžę į „Windows“, patikrinkite, ar jis aktyvus: atidarykite užduočių tvarkytuvę (Ctrl + Shift + Esc) > skirtuką „Našumas“ > patikrinkite, ar skiltyje „Procesorius“ rodoma „Virtualizacija: įjungta“. Jei ne, dar kartą patikrinkite BIOS. Vien tai išsprendžia „ Hyper-V Virtual Switch“ klaidą daugeliui vartotojų!
2 veiksmas: atnaujinkite tinklo tvarkykles ir „Windows“
Pasenusios tvarkyklės yra „Hyper-V“ košmaras. Atnaujinkime jas.
- Dešiniuoju pelės mygtuku spustelėkite Pradėti > Įrenginių tvarkytuvė .
- Išskleiskite Tinklo adapteriai > Dešiniuoju pelės mygtuku spustelėkite adapterį > Atnaujinti tvarkyklę > Ieškoti automatiškai.
- Jei atnaujinimų nėra, apsilankykite gamintojo svetainėje (pvz., „Intel“ arba „Realtek“) ir atsisiųskite naujausius tvarkykles.
- Tada eikite į „Nustatymai“ > „Windows“ naujinimas > Tikrinti, ar yra naujinimų. Įdiekite visus galimus pataisymus, nes naujausios „Windows 11“ versijos pagerino „Hyper-V“ stabilumą.
Profesionalo patarimas: naudokite ir integruotą trikčių šalinimo įrankį – ieškokite „Tinklo adapterio trikčių šalinimo įrankio“ skiltyje „Nustatymai“ > „Sistema“ > „Trikčių šalinimas“. Jis dažnai automatiškai aptinka ir išsprendžia virtualių komutatorių konfliktus. Jau jaučiatės optimistiškai? Esate teisingame kelyje! 😊
3 veiksmas: iš naujo nustatykite „Hyper-V“ komponentus
Jei klaida išlieka, problema gali būti sugadinti failai. Laikas atlikti iš naujo nustatymus neprarandant duomenų.
- Atidarykite „PowerShell“ kaip administratorius (dešiniuoju pelės mygtuku spustelėkite Pradėti > Terminalas (administratorius) > Perjungti į „PowerShell“).
- Vykdykite šias komandas po vieną (po kiekvienos paspauskite „Enter“):
Disable-WindowsOptionalFeature -Online -FeatureName Microsoft-Hyper-V-All
Enable-WindowsOptionalFeature -Online -FeatureName Microsoft-Hyper-V -All
Restart-Computer
Tai išjungia ir vėl įjungia „Hyper-V“, atnaujindama visus komponentus, įskaitant virtualų komutatorių . Po perkrovimo atidarykite „Hyper-V Manager“ ir pabandykite sukurti naują jungiklį naudodami virtualių komutatorių tvarkyklę.
Vis dar užstrigote? Nesijaudinkite – mūsų laukia dar daugiau ugnies galios.
4 veiksmas: pašalinkite konfliktuojančią programinę įrangą ir patikrinkite leidimus
Trečiųjų šalių programos gali pakenkti jūsų sąrankai. Laikinai išjunkite antivirusinę programą (pvz., „Norton“ arba „McAfee“) arba VPN, pvz., „ExpressVPN“, tada išbandykite „Hyper-V“.
Taip pat įsitikinkite, kad naudojate administratoriaus teises: dešiniuoju pelės mygtuku spustelėkite „Hyper-V Manager“ > „Vykdyti administratoriaus teisėmis“. Jei kyla didesnių konfliktų, naudokite šią „PowerShell“ komandą, kad išvardytumėte ir pašalintumėte paslėptus virtualius jungiklius:
Get-VMSwitch | Remove-VMSwitch -Force
Vėliau juos sukurkite iš naujo. Jei naudojate prie domeno prijungtą kompiuterį, patikrinkite grupės politiką, ar nėra apribojimų (gpedit.msc > Kompiuterio konfigūracija > Administravimo šablonai > Tinklas).
5 veiksmas: išplėstiniai pataisymai – SFC nuskaitymas ir registro pakeitimai
Atkakliais atvejais paleiskite sistemos failų patikrinimus. Atidarykite komandų eilutę kaip administratorius ir vykdykite:
sfc /scannow
DISM /Online /Cleanup-Image /RestoreHealth
Šie failai taiso sugadintus sistemos failus, kurie gali turėti įtakos „Hyper-V Virtual Switch“ .
Jei reikia, atlikite greitą registro patikrinimą: paspauskite „Win + R“ > „regedit“ > eikite į H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Virtualization. Įsitikinkite, kad nėra keistų įrašų; pirmiausia sukurkite registro atsarginę kopiją (Failas > Eksportuoti).
Dėmesio: registro redagavimas gali būti sudėtingas – darykite tai atsargiai. Jei tai atrodo pernelyg sudėtinga, apsilankykite oficialiuose „Microsoft“ palaikymo forumuose, kur rasite individualizuotų patarimų.
Trikčių šalinimo lentelė: trumpas „Hyper-V“ klaidų aprašymas
Kad būtų dar paprasčiau, pateikiame patogią lentelę, kurioje apibendrintos dažniausiai pasitaikančios „Windows 11 Hyper-V“ problemos ir jų sprendimai:
| Klaidos pranešimas |
Galima priežastis |
Greitas pataisymas |
| „Nepavyko sukurti virtualaus jungiklio“ |
BIOS virtualizacija išjungta |
Įjunkite VT-x BIOS |
| „Tinklo adapteris nesusietas“ |
Vairuotojų konfliktas |
Atnaujinkite tvarkykles per įrenginių tvarkytuvę |
| „Hyper-V jungiklio klaida 0x80070490“ |
Sugadinti komponentai |
Iš naujo nustatykite „Hyper-V“ naudodami „PowerShell“ |
| „Nepakanka išteklių“ |
Mažai RAM / CPU |
VM nustatymuose paskirstyti daugiau |
Ši lentelė yra jūsų atmintinė – pasižymėkite ją žymėmis, kad galėtumėte ją peržiūrėti ateityje! 📌
Būsimų „Hyper-V“ virtualiųjų komutatorių klaidų prevencija
Dabar, kai įveikėte klaidą, pabandykime jos išvengti. Reguliariai atnaujinkite „Windows“ ir tvarkykles, venkite naudoti kelis hipervizorius (pvz., „VirtualBox“ kartu su „Hyper-V“) ir stebėkite išteklių naudojimą užduočių tvarkytuvėje. Profesionalų patarimų rasite „Microsoft Hyper-V“ dokumentacijoje – tai tikras aukso kasykla.
Premija: jei domitės automatizavimu, tokie įrankiai kaip „PowerShell“ scenarijai gali stebėti jūsų virtualaus komutatoriaus būklę. Būkite iniciatyvūs ir retai kada vėl pamatysite šią klaidą.
Apibendrinimas: Jūs tai turite!
Sveikiname, kad pavyko! „Windows 11 Hyper-V Virtual Switch“ klaidos ištaisymas nebūtinai turi būti galvos skausmas. Atlikę šiuos veiksmus, galėsite su ja susidoroti kaip profesionalas. Jei vienas pataisymas nepadeda, kitas padės – atkaklumas atsiperka. 🚀
Turite klausimų ar unikalų šios klaidos paaiškinimą? Parašykite komentarą apačioje; mielai padėsiu. Dabar paleiskite virtualias mašinas ir mėgaukitės nepertraukiama virtualizacija. Jūs to nusipelnėte! 🎉